first attempt at a direct conversion receiver, got audio but its a mess

so ive been at this for about three weeks now, built a direct conversion receiver for 40m loosely based on the NorCal design but i swapped out a few parts because i couldnt source the exact values locally. getting audio out of it which is exciting but the problem is there's this massive hum riding on everything and when i touch the coil form it shifts the frequency noticeably. like i can tune in SSB signals and actually hear voices which feels like a miracle honestly but the hum is bad enough that its hard to copy anything weak.

the LO is a colpitts oscillator running around 7 MHz, wound on a t50-2 toroid. power supply is just a wall wart i had laying around, regulated 12v but maybe thats the issue? i havent put it in a box yet either, everything is just sitting on a piece of copper clad with the components tacked down. i measured about 80mV of ripple on the supply rail which seems like a lot but im not sure what the threshold should be for this kind of circuit. any ideas where to start chasing this down?

80mV of ripple is definitely going to cause you grief in a direct conversion rig. the problem is the audio frequencies you care about are literally the same frequency range as the ripple artifacts so they mix right into your demodulated audio in a way that a superhet would mostly reject. slap a 78L09 or even just a LM317 set to around 9V with some decent filter caps right at the board, like 470uF followed by a 10 ohm resistor followed by another 220uF, and see if that clears up the hum. seriously that alone might fix 90% of it.

the hand capacitance thing on the coil is pretty normal for an unshielded oscillator sitting out in the open. once you get it in a metal enclosure and maybe put a small can around the VFO section that'll settle down a lot. i built a similar thing a few years back and spent two weeks chasing hum before i realized my bench supply had a bad filter cap. always suspect the power supply first with audio stuff.

yeah whats your bypass situation look like on the mixer chip or however youre doing the mixing? sometimes people forget to bypass the supply right at the IC and the trace inductance is enough to let noise couple in. also what are you using for the product detector stage, a diode ring or one of the SA612 type chips?

not trying to pile on but the unboxed thing really does matter more than people think, ive had rigs that worked fine on the bench and then picked up all kinds of garbage once i put them near a computer or a switching supply. shielding a direct conversion is kind of annoying because you have to be careful not to change the coil geometry when you close the lid but its worth doing early rather than retrofitting later.
